Often referred to as the powerhouse of the cell, which organelle supplies the cell with chemical energy in the form of the high-energy molecule adenosine triphosphate?

Correct Answer

mitochondria

Explanation

Mitochondria are the powerhouses of the cell, supplying chemical energy in the form of ATP (adenosine triphosphate). ATP is the universal energy currency of the cell, used in cell division, muscle contraction, active transport, and countless other cellular activities. Mitochondria are most abundant in cells with high energy demands, such as muscle cells and liver cells.
